    Abstract:

    The hydrocarbon source beds of the Upper Ordovician Wufeng Formation and the Lower Silurian Longmaxi Formation were deposited in the Yangtze area.It is important in theory and practice to probe the mechanism of the development of marine hydrocarbon source beds,i.e.the precondition of breakthrough in the exploration of the marine strata in South China.From the Late Ordovician epoch,the Yangtze area began clastic shelf evolutionary phase.In Wufeng and Longmaxi age of the Late Ordovician and Early Silurian,the study area was mainly a restricted deep shelf.The paleogeographic framework was formed by the coexistence of shallow and deep shelves and bathyal environment.The distribution of sedimentary systems and sedimentary evolution were controlled by convergent squeezing of the Yangtze and Cathaysian platforms.The organic-rich source beds of the Upper Ordovician and the Lower Silurian in the Yangtze area are intimately related to these factors as following:the high organism production and bury,the rapid rise of sea level caused by a rapid increase of temperatures and melting of glaciers,between a glacial age and a postglacial age,enrichment of phosphorus element and the adsorption of clay minerals during the preservation of organic matter.
